CHARITABLE GAMING ACTIVITY
| LINCOLN – October-December 2008 Dollars Wagered: Tax Commissioner Douglas Ewald reported on Wednesday that total dollars wagered on charitable gaming activities for the period of October through December 2008 were $64.1 million, which is a 0.5% decrease from the previous quarter. |
| |
• Bingo |
$2.4 million |
|
| |
• Pickle Cards |
9.1 million |
|
| |
• Keno |
50.9 million |
|
| |
• Lottery/Raffle |
1.7 million |
|
| 2008 Dollars Wagered: Total dollars wagered on charitable gaming activities for 2008 were $265.5 million, which is 1.2% more than 2007, when $262.4 million was wagered. |

| 2008 Tax Receipts: Tax receipts from charitable gaming activities for 2008 were $5.6 million, which is 0.8% more than 2007. |

| 2008 License and Registration Fees: License and registration fees from charitable gaming activities in 2008 were $292,000 compared to $323,000 in 2007. |
